Code P1702 2003 Infiniti G35 Description

The transmission solenoids and valves are controlled by the Transmission Control Module (TCM) in response to signals sent from the Park & Neutral Position (PNP) Switch,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S), and Accelerator Pedal Position (APP) Sensor (Throttle Position Sensor). The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) will set when the TCM memory Random Access Memory (RAM) is malfunctioning.
OBDII Code P1702 2003 Infiniti G35 - Transmission Control Module RAM - AutoCodes.com
P1702 2003 Infiniti G35 Code - Transmission Control Module RAM

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P1702 2003 Infiniti G35?

  • Faulty Transmission Control Module (TCM)
  • Transmission Control Module harness is open or shorted
  • Transmission Control Module circuit poor electrical connection

How to Fix the DTC P1702 2003 Infiniti G35?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the P1702 2003 Infiniti G35 code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.
